Learning outcomes

At the end of the workshop the student:

- knows the methodological techniques of observation of behaviour;

- is able to apply observational techniques to the evaluation of educational projects;

- can realize materials and documentation functional to the knowledge of various educational contexts;

- is able to integrate his/her knowledge and his/her own instruments with the tools of other disciplines.

Course contents

The course will describe the main observational techniques in developmental psychology: narrative descriptions, coding system, checklists, rating scales and questionnaires. Furthermore, the course will present some observational tools that can be used by students on the workplace. Both in reference to the description of the general characteristics of the observational method and in relation to the instruments, several exercises and activities will be carried out in the classroom in order to allow the students to apply the techniques of observation.

Teaching methods

Several classroom exercises will propose through the presentation of videos and observational protocols.

The classroom exercises are particularly important to understand the observation techniques through their application, discussing the difficulties and advantages and limitations of each method of observation.

Assessment methods

Assessment method consists of the application of a technique of observation (for example, the student may be asked to comment an observational protocol, a coding scheme or to draw up a narrative observation while watching a video). The final evaluation will consist in an elegibility.
